## Session Handling for Health Checks

The Corvel gateway sits behind the Lanternside load balancer, which probes /healthz every ten seconds. Health-check requests are stateless by design: they bypass the session store entirely so that probe traffic never inflates session counts or evicts real user sessions. New team members should note that the deep-check endpoint, /healthz/deep, does verify session-store connectivity and therefore requires authentication. When probing it manually, supply the token below.

bearer token for tajep-kajef: eyJhbGciOiJIUzI1NiIsInR5cCI6IkpXVCJ9.eyJzdWIiOiIoOsZ23In0.CsygO0hs

09:47 — BounceSort processor resumed after the stalled DKIM verification stage was restarted. Backlog of 12k bounce events drained by 10:15. No evidence of message tampering; signatures on replayed events all validated. Access logs for the stall window were exported for review. The redeployed worker image is identified by the token directly below.

pipeline stamp: htk31_f769b577b3028a4e9958e5bb8d1259a

Subject: Handover — Trace Pipeline Release Duties

Hi,

Taking over from me this sprint: releases for the Marrowgate trace pipeline. Main thing to know is that trace IDs propagate through seven services, and the collector rejects events from unsigned builds. Release checklist lives in the runbook; cut on Wednesdays only. Before your first release, register the deploy credential with the collector. The signing key is below.

deploy key for kahof-tadup: bky4_rRMZ

Effective next quarter, legacy customers on the Vantrel Classic plan will see a 9% price increase, the first adjustment since the plan closed to new sign-ups. Modeling by the pricing group at Harwick Analytics suggests churn of under 4%, concentrated in low-margin accounts. Invoicing updates go live on the first billing cycle of the quarter; notification letters ship 60 days prior. Finance should update revenue forecasts and deferred-income schedules accordingly. The rationale below is confidential and not for customer-facing use.

board note of bajop-yaweg: The western region missed its Pelys quota by 58.0 percent last quarter. Pelysek Foods plans to raise the Belius list price by 44.0 percent in July. The steering committee signed off on a budget of $133.8 million for Project Pelax. The renewal with Zoraelix Systems closes at $61.9 million a year, 12.7 percent above the last contract.